Output 058f57be623d03f6623cf75dd2e3124925decfaf64db4a879b38c682a2c93078:1

value
210079600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ec74dfd6246e678628aa0faf17ad3681a07e1b OP_EQUAL
address
31muBqDoxDfwr1wgDjPmyUaViDGcL93yaC
transaction
058f57be623d03f6623cf75dd2e3124925decfaf64db4a879b38c682a2c93078
spent
true